Live at Village West is a live album by bassist Ron Carter and guitarist Jim Hall recorded in New York City in 1982 and released on the Concord Jazz label.[1][2]

The AllMusic review by Ken Dryden said "The second live collaboration between bassist Ron Carter and guitarist Jim Hall follows their first recording together by a decade, but their chemistry together is every bit as strong, if not improved ... Highly recommended".[3]
Track listing
- "Bag's Groove" (Milt Jackson) – 4:11
- "All the Things You Are" (Jerome Kern, Oscar Hammerstein II) – 5:38
- "Blue Monk" (Thelonious Monk) – 5:07
- "New Waltz" (Ron Carter) – 6:01
- "St. Thomas" (Sonny Rollins) – 4:27
- "Embraceable You" (George Gershwin, Ira Gershwin) – 6:37
- "Laverne Walk" (Oscar Pettiford) – 5:13
- "Baubles, Bangles, & Beads" (Robert Wright, George Forrest) – 5:02
Personnel
- Ron Carter - bass
- Jim Hall – guitar
